Todd Glass' Bio

Todd Glass started doing stand-up comedy when he was in high school. By the time he was 18, Todd was opening for music legends like Patti LaBelle, Aretha Franklin, and Diana Ross on Broadway. Over the following decades, Todd built a career that established him as one of the most original and respected voices in comedy. The late great Norm Macdonald affectionately called Todd Glass "the comedian's comedian's comedian." Todd's autobiography, The Todd Glass Situation, detailing his struggles with dyslexia, ADD, and coming out later in life, was published by Simon & Schuster and led to him being featured in the documentary "Outstanding: A Comedy Revolution" which is currently streaming on Netflix along with his critically acclaimed stand up specials. More recently, Todd voiced the principal on HBO Max's Ten Year Old Tom. In the past year, Todd saw a massive growth in his audience, especially among a new generation of younger fans, through his short form skits on TikTok and Instagram.
